We have some rubberized flooring we bought last year for out CTC. Talked to an RV service tech, who recommended the right adhesive for it, the plan is to make a taped together cardboard template , lay that on top of the flooring and then cut it. Now I am wondering what will work best to cut it with. I have scissors made for regular vinyl flooring, but it is not strong enough to cut it. Looking for ideas and suggestions about what others have used.
